Q. Is geriatric constipation difficult to treat?
Geriatric constipation often presents as the 'Qi-deficiency type,' characterized by weakened bowel function. Instead of relying on strong laxatives, using a tonic that invigorates vital energy (Qi) will lead to gentle improvement.
